Title
Reduction of rectangular waveguide cross-section with metamaterials: A new approach

Abstract
A new approach to design a metamaterial surface (meta-surface) with the objective of reducing the waveguide´s cutoff frequency of the fundamental mode is proposed. From an analytical study of the dispersion diagrams of waveguides with anisotropic walls, a hypothesis for the surface impedances is set up. By means of this new hypothesis, the design of a unit-cell is optimized. Finally, the periodically arranged meta-surface is implemented in a miniaturized waveguide and the simulation results are compared to the ones of a metallic waveguide in order to validate the approach.
